Kerala launches four-year undergraduate programmes in all universities

Kerala's educational reforms, led by CM Vijayan, prioritize student freedom and a dual-focused approach to education. The launch of new undergraduate programmes aims to revolutionize the higher education sector by emphasizing skill development and individualized curriculum design.
